‘Fernando Alonso’s form will dip over the next year or two’Former F1 racer Marc Surer believes it is only a matter of time until Fernando Alonso’s form starts to dip, agreeing with Alpine’s contract call.

Alonso has cut and run from Alpine, signing a new multi-year deal with Aston Martin to replace retiring Sebastian Vettel. This was after AlpineAlpine team boss Otmar Szafnauer told reporters: “There comes a time when something happens physiologically to a driver and you don’t have the same abilities you did when you were younger.

It is a sentiment shared by F1 broadcaster and former racer Surer, who believes Alonso’s speed could evaporate in the near future as he advances into his early 40s.“He can maybe continue in this form for another year or two. I am [sure] at some point it will subside. , Alonso could be attracted by the long-term project being undertaken by the Silverstone-based squad who, under Lawrence Stroll, have seen significant investment in recent years.
